We are using outlook 2003 set up for a POP3 server. We
exported the contacts out of outlook express into a tab
delaminated exces file. Then we imported from that
same
file into contacts in outlook 2003. When you open
contacts in outlook everything is there, including e-
mail
addresses all in the correct locations etc. However,
when you click "new" to send an e-mail, then "to" to
select a recipient, there aren't any contacts to
select,
just as if none of the contacts had e-mail addresses
listed.
I have verified that the e-mail addresses were correct,
and that they were resolved in contact records. I have
found that there are no other lists in the "show names
from drop down menu. I have also manualy entered a new
contact with information that I know is correct, but when
you start a new e-mail, and click on "to" to pull an
address from contacts, the list is blank as if you don't
have any contacts with e-mail addresses.
Any ideas?

Are you sure this Contacts Folder has been enabled as an email address book
in its properties?
